Krutch
good boot great price
March 13, 2010
"Ive loved these boots. First the design is sick and the gold buckles are amazing. water tight and really good fit. I wore size 12 shoe when i ordered these and i ordered 13 boot. fit great then and now im a 13 shoe and they still fit great. Ive had them for about 8 months and nothing went wrong until i got them caught in my wheel. took half the spokes of a wheel spinning open throttle 2nd gear to tear a bit of the rubber off the bottom and my foot was untouched. Out of all the falls ive taken, my feet are the least scarred. Amazing deal for the price and perfect for anyone getting into the sport with a limited budget"

Moto Tassinari is the leader in reed valve technology. Their V-Force 3 Reed Valve System will help increase the power and performance of your motorcycle or ATV. Key Features on the V-Force 3 Reed Valve System: Rubber over-molded reed cages to promote long reed life. The unique and proven design of the V-Force 3 Reed Valve System doubles the available reed tip surface over a conventional reed valve design. The V-Force 3 Reed Valve System design widens peak power and increases the horsepower over the entire range of the power band. The V-Force 3 Reed Valve System incorporates the industry's first and only patented snap together reed valve design. The entire assembly is completely screw free, meaning that when reed petals need changing the job is now literally a "SNAP".
